Welcome to the Humphrey Institute Words of Wisdom Project!

Thanks for visiting the blog! As we all have learned, the best resource for navigating our way through classes, finding great internships, and successfully landing a job is the words of wisdom we collect from our fellow classmates. This blog has been established as a space where current Humphrey students can pass along the information that next year's incoming class needs to know about professors, courses, working while in school, and all that other stuff we learned from each other as well as through the school of hard knocks.

Every few days I will post a new topic, share some of my own thoughts, and then pose some questions for people to answer the comments section. I am also open to opening things up for guest blog entries as well.

A few rules of the road:

1. This is a public space being hosted by a member of the Public Affairs Student Association. While the goal is to maintain a spirit of candor, please don't post anything derogatory or otherwise embarrassing to yourself or the Institute. Such content will be removed on the discretion of the host.

2. Keep postings on topic. Topic suggestions are always welcome, but maybe wait until the topic comes up before starting a comment string about it. This will make it easier for the incoming students to search the different postings by topic.

3. Try to be as specific as you can about stuff. Tell stories. Post links. Make your entries interesting!

That's basically it! Thanks again for visiting....
